Principal Software Engineer, Data Architecture

Mastercard

Verified listing
O'Fallon, Missouri · Arlington, Virginia · New York City, NY Posted 75 days ago $170,000$281,000 / year

At a glance

AI generated

TL;DR

As a Principal Software Engineer in Data Architecture at Mastercard’s Data & Analytics organization, you will serve as the senior technical authority, shaping and evolving the global enterprise data architecture. This role involves setting the architectural vision for modernizing data platforms across hybrid cloud and on-premises environments to support both high-throughput batch processing and low-latency real-time use cases. You will define and evolve the global data architecture roadmap, architect secure and resilient solutions meeting regulatory mandates like GDPR, and champion Data Mesh principles. Additionally, you will drive adoption of modern data technologies such as Databricks, Snowflake, Delta Lake, and streaming platforms while mentoring engineering teams globally. The ideal candidate has extensive experience in designing distributed data systems at scale, hands-on expertise with Apache Spark, Kafka, Flink, and NiFi, and a strong understanding of data governance and regulatory compliance in global environments.

Skills

AWS Azure GCP Databricks Snowflake Delta Lake Apache Spark Kafka Flink NiFi CI/CD Data Mesh GDPR ISO 20022 Agile SAFe Python Java SQL PostgreSQL

What you'll do

  • Define and evolve the global data architecture roadmap for hybrid cloud environments.
  • Architect secure, resilient solutions to meet global regulatory mandates like GDPR.
  • Champion Data Mesh principles for federated ownership and self-service enablement.
  • Lead modernization of legacy data platforms to cloud-native architectures on AWS, Azure, GCP.
  • Drive adoption of modern data technologies such as Databricks, Snowflake, Delta Lake.
  • Enable real-time and batch analytics use cases for high availability workloads.
  • Mentor global engineering teams and foster a culture of technical excellence.

What we're looking for

  • Proven experience as a Principal Engineer or equivalent in enterprise data architecture.
  • Deep expertise in designing and operating global-scale distributed data systems.
  • Hands-on experience with modern data technologies like Databricks, Snowflake, Delta Lake.
  • Success in modernizing legacy data platforms to cloud-native architectures (AWS, Azure).
  • Strong understanding of data governance, security, and compliance in regulated environments.
  • Ability to lead architectural initiatives within Agile or product-centric delivery models.
  • Proven skill in influencing technical and business decisions at the executive level.

Market check

Salary context

Above market

How this pay compares to similar roles

Similar $189k
This role $226k
$126k most similar roles pay here $298k

This role pays more than 80% of similar roles. Most pay $160,962–$216,300 — the shaded band above. At the midpoint, this role pays about $226k versus about $189k for comparable roles.

Based on 240 similar postings.

Employer

About Mastercard

Mastercard is a global technology company in the payments industry, processing transactions between financial institutions and merchants using its extensive network of credit, debit, and prepaid card products. Industry: Payments Technology & Financial Services

Mastercard currently has 4 open roles on FindRole.

Most-posted roles

View all roles at Mastercard

More like this

Similar roles

Principal Data Engineer

Genworth Financial

Remote (Richmond, VA) 72 days ago $120,000$120,000
Databricks Python Spark CI/CD Kafka Medallion OneLake Azure PostgreSQL Snowflake Git Jira Confluence Agile GCP AWS Terraform Kubernetes Prometheus Grafana
Remote Hybrid

Principal Data Engineer

McDonald’s Corporation

Chicago, Illinois 7 days ago $195,371$244,214
GCP Airflow Python Kubernetes Terraform PostgreSQL Docker CI/CD Prometheus Grafana Apache Kafka Spark Snowflake Git Jenkins GraphQL REST Swagger OAuth JSON SQL

Software Engineer, Data Solutions ASE

Apple Inc

New York City, NY 13 days ago $147,400$272,100
Apache_Kafka Java Kubernetes AWS GCP Cassandra Redis RESTful_APIs Service_Oriented_Architecture Docker CI/CD Prometheus Grafana Chaos_Engineering Property_Based_Testing

Senior Data Engineer & Architect

Adobe

San Jose 79 days ago $228,600$331,050
Snowflake Airflow Python SQL Spark Kafka AWS CI/CD Docker Git Redshift BigQuery dbt Great Expectations Atlan Collibra MLOps Terraform PostgreSQL

Data Architect, Lead

Booz Allen Hamilton

Chantilly, VA 5 days ago $99,000$225,000
Python Scala R Closure Cloud computing Data architecture Big data analytics Machine learning Artificial intelligence Database design CI/CD